Eight housing associations are to share a £510,000 investment from the Scottish Government towards electric hire car clubs to allow people to rent low-emission vehicles. The Plugged-in Households Grant Fund will support the associations to procure the services of car clubs.

Kevin Scarlett Eighteen housing associations in Scotland - including the Haymarket Group of associations - have agreed to take part in a sector scorecard pilot to benchmark a range of business health and efficiency measures.

A wind turbine project supported by Ore Valley Housing Association has started to produce green energy for the first time. The Dundonald Wind Turbine in Cardenden was launched by the Ore Valley Group, which is led by the Association.
